Dr. Abigail Moore, a paediatric dentist, shares her thoughts on maternity wear

Pre-bump I was wearing mostly koi Ashley and Katelyn tops with Karlie or Lindsey pants in size extra small (XS).

By about week 18-20 the Katelyn top was proving to be an overhead struggle in the chest area so I moved up a size!! I still found my XS Ashley roomy enough though.  At this stage I tried a patterned Kathryn top in a size small which suited the mini bump well as it tied under the bust & highlighted my new curves!  I found the Karlie pants a bit tight and high waisted so moved up to a small in the Lindseys which were really comfy as they sat low, under the bump and the elasticated waist made them easy to get on.

At about 24-28 weeks my original Ashley tops were a bit tight in the midriff so a size up was called for.  As it was coming into winter I loved the extra warmth of the Harlow tops with the snuggly cotton under t-shirt.  The Kathryn was still fitting well in a small and I added another patterned top, a Rylee which was a bit less fitted and sat loosly under the bust.

I am now at 35 weeks and still growing rapidly.  I have moved up to a medium Ashley which is deffo the most comfy at this stage.  I find the more fitted tops with under bust ties aren’t working so well now as they are very big on the shoulders if they are big enough to fit the bump!  I am still in the Lindsey pants only a size up from BB (before bump).  They are so comfy and don’t interfere with bending as they are low slung.
